If you arrange the insurance yourself then the answer is yes - your insurance company probably won't do anything except add the information to your notes - they almost certainly won't increase the premium. If your company insures the car then I would say no - there will be a blanket policy covering all the company's cars and drivers, for which the insurers charge a high premium as they are insuring people who may be good, bad or indifferent drivers and who may have a variety of health conditions. They can't expect an employer to divulge the health of every person who might drive one of their cars as the employer won't necessarily have this information.
